Linus Torvalds
89f883372f
Merge tag 'kvm-3.9-1' of git://git.kernel.org/pub/scm/virt/kvm/kvm
...
Pull KVM updates from Marcelo Tosatti:
"KVM updates for the 3.9 merge window, including x86 real mode
emulation fixes, stronger memory slot interface restrictions, mmu_lock
spinlock hold time reduction, improved handling of large page faults
on shadow, initial APICv HW acceleration support, s390 channel IO
based virtio, amongst others"
* tag 'kvm-3.9-1' of git://git.kernel.org/pub/scm/virt/kvm/kvm: (143 commits)
Revert "KVM: MMU: lazily drop large spte"
x86: pvclock kvm: align allocation size to page size
KVM: nVMX: Remove redundant get_vmcs12 from nested_vmx_exit_handled_msr
x86 emulator: fix parity calculation for AAD instruction
KVM: PPC: BookE: Handle alignment interrupts
booke: Added DBCR4 SPR number
KVM: PPC: booke: Allow multiple exception types
KVM: PPC: booke: use vcpu reference from thread_struct
KVM: Remove user_alloc from struct kvm_memory_slot
KVM: VMX: disable apicv by default
KVM: s390: Fix handling of iscs.
KVM: MMU: cleanup __direct_map
KVM: MMU: remove pt_access in mmu_set_spte
KVM: MMU: cleanup mapping-level
KVM: MMU: lazily drop large spte
KVM: VMX: cleanup vmx_set_cr0().
KVM: VMX: add missing exit names to VMX_EXIT_REASONS array
KVM: VMX: disable SMEP feature when guest is in non-paging mode
KVM: Remove duplicate text in api.txt
Revert "KVM: MMU: split kvm_mmu_free_page"
...
2013-02-24 13:07:18 -08:00
..
2009-12-12 13:08:15 +01:00
2009-03-24 11:03:13 +02:00
2013-01-11 11:38:03 -08:00
2010-03-01 12:35:52 -03:00
2009-06-28 14:10:30 +03:00
2008-12-31 16:51:49 +02:00
2012-12-13 23:24:38 -02:00
2013-01-29 10:48:19 +02:00
2011-03-17 14:02:56 +01:00
2008-05-18 14:34:16 +03:00
2008-05-18 14:34:16 +03:00
2008-12-31 16:51:49 +02:00
2010-11-01 15:38:34 -04:00
2009-06-10 11:48:29 +03:00
2011-03-31 11:26:23 -03:00
2008-04-27 12:01:08 +03:00
2010-03-01 12:36:07 -03:00
2009-12-27 13:36:33 -02:00
2010-03-03 11:26:00 +01:00
2012-06-28 11:44:36 +02:00
2011-05-22 08:39:57 -04:00
2009-12-27 13:36:33 -02:00